C9K-PWR-1500WAC=: How Does Cisco’s 1500W AC Power Supply Support High-Density Catalyst 9000 Switch Deployments?



​Overview of the C9K-PWR-1500WAC=​

The ​​Cisco C9K-PWR-1500WAC=​​ is a ​​1500W AC power supply​​ designed for ​​Catalyst 9000 Series Switches​​, including the Catalyst 9300, 9400, and 9500 platforms. Engineered for environments demanding high power redundancy and scalability, this unit supports ​​N+N or N+1 power redundancy​​ while delivering consistent performance in PoE++ and non-PoE deployments.


​Key Technical Specifications​

  • ​Input Voltage​​: 100–240V AC (50/60 Hz) with ​​auto-sensing capability​​.
  • ​Efficiency​​: ​​94% efficiency​​ (80+ Platinum equivalent), reducing energy waste and operational costs.
  • ​Output Capacity​​: 1500W total output, supporting ​​up to 30W per port​​ for PoE++ devices like Cisco’s C9300-48UXM switch.
  • ​Compatibility​​: Works with ​​Catalyst 9300/9400/9500 chassis​​ running IOS XE 17.3 or later.

​Critical Deployment Scenarios​

  • ​AI-Driven Campus Networks​​: Powers ​​Cisco DNA Spaces​​ sensors and Wi-Fi 6E APs requiring 30W+ per device.
  • ​Industrial IoT Hubs​​: Sustains PoE++ for ​​IP67-rated cameras and environmental sensors​​ in harsh conditions.
  • ​Modular Data Centers​​: Enables ​​hot-swappable power redundancy​​ for spine-leaf architectures.

​Installation and Maintenance Best Practices​

  • ​Load Balancing​​: Distribute PoE loads evenly across multiple PSUs to avoid ​​asymmetrical current draw​​.
  • ​Thermal Management​​: Maintain ​​2U vertical spacing​​ between power supplies for optimal airflow.
  • ​Firmware Syncing​​: Ensure PSU firmware matches the switch’s IOS XE version (e.g., ​​17.6.1a​​ resolves fan-speed bugs).
  • ​Grounding​​: Use ​​6 AWG copper grounding cables​​ to mitigate electrical noise in industrial settings.
